Acute Stroke Care Summary

Acute Stroke Care by Ken Uchino

You have just encountered a possible stroke patient. You ask yourself: what should I do first? How do I know it is a stroke? Is it too late to reverse the damage? How do I do the right things in the right order? This book will help you answer these critical questions. It provides practical advice on the care of stroke patients in a range of acute settings. The content is arranged in chronological order, covering the things to consider in assessing and treating the patient in the emergency department, the stroke unit and then on transfer to a rehabilitation facility. All types of stroke are covered. This new edition provides updated information from recently completed clinical trials and added information on endovascular therapy, hemicraniectomy for severe stroke, DVT prophylaxis and stroke prevention. A comprehensive set of appendices contain useful reference information including dosing algorithms, conversion factors and stroke scales.

About Ken Uchino

Ken Uchino is a vascular neurologist at the Cerebrovascular Center, Cleveland Clinic Foundation, Ohio, USA. Jennifer Pary is a vascular neurologist at the Center for Neurosciences, Orthopedics and Spine, Dakota Dunes, South Dakota, USA. James C. Grotta is Professor and Chairman at the Department of Neurology, University of Texas Medical School, Houston.
